Rising Islamophobia following terrorists threats

On 14 November, Emad Al Swealmeen, an asylum seeker from Syria, died when his homemade device exploded outside Liverpool Women’s Hospital in the UK. The failed terrorist attack prompted the government to raise the threat level in the country from “substantial” to “severe”- meaning another attack is highly likely. EU proposition to tax the big capital groups

European Comission proposed to implement a 15% taxation on profit for companies and capital groups with revenue of at least 750 mln euro. Download the video

Water crisis in Portugal

Recent studies shows that Portugal could face a severe shortage of water in the upcoming decades. How can the country tackle this problem and keep a productive and sustainable agriculture, responsible for 70% of the water consuption? Download the video
